Default Chicken riggies

Chicken riggies are a way of preparing chicken, rigatoni and veggies
in a spicy tomato based sauce. Many chefs use more of a vodka sauce
than marinara, but there are countless variations of the recipe.
Chicken riggies originate from central New York in Utica. See

I forgot to quote the recipe from above.
Quoted

"
Ingredients:

• 4 Tbsp butter
• 2-1/2 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ite size
pieces
• 8 oz pkg mushrooms, sliced
• 1 medium green pepper, chopped
• 1 medium hot pepper, chopped (optional)
• 1 medium onion, chopped
• 2 cups water
• 2 tsp chicken bouillon OR 2 cubes
• 1 cup tomato sauce
• 1/2 pint heavy cream
• 1 tsp paprika
• 1 tsp parsley
• 1/4 tsp salt
• 1/4 tsp black pepper
• 1/2 cup black olives
• 2 Tbsp cornstarch
• 1 lb rigatoni, cooked & drained
Method:

In a large pot, melt butter and add chicken. Cook over medium heat
until tender Add mushrooms and cook 5 minutes. Add peppers and
onions and continue cooking until soft, about 5-7 minutes. Add
water, bouillon, sauce, heavy cream and spices. Bring to a boil,
reduce heat, cover and simmer for 20 minutes, stirring occasionally
Add olives and simmer 5 minutes more. In a small bowl, mix
cornstarch with 2 Tbsp water until it dissolves. Add to the sauce,
stirring continuously until it thickens. When thickened, mix sauce
with rigatoni together in deep bowl and serve immediately. Sprinkle
with parmesan cheese
Notes:


Number of servings: 8
